1

Rumored Buzz on baglamukhi

News Discuss 
Going to temples: A lot of temples committed to Maa Baglamukhi are available in India as well as other portions of the world. Viewing these temples and taking part in rituals and prayers can be a robust way to connect While using the goddess. Maa Baglamukhi is a strong and https://www.youtube.com/shorts/5VeSyP9JRw0

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story